Output 25edb4236862f91a825d61f9f4e756d813281f8c08052c4175361f1bac859d65:17

value
81868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8bfb3800abe1eb8338102349a9b31e4d5379933 OP_EQUAL
address
3JXsuUJU5Uz49m4LFjhUyKP697JHxiYrWa
transaction
25edb4236862f91a825d61f9f4e756d813281f8c08052c4175361f1bac859d65
spent
true